Welcome to mirror list, hosted at ThFree Co, Russian Federation.

github.com/videolan/dav1d.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
path: root/src/x86
AgeCommit message (Expand)Author
2021-11-15x86: Add high bitdepth mc blend AVX-512 (Ice Lake) asmHenrik Gramner
2021-11-15x86: Add high bitdepth mc warp_affine_8x8 AVX-512 (Ice Lake) asmHenrik Gramner
2021-11-15x86: Add high bitdepth mc bidir AVX-512 (Ice Lake) asmHenrik Gramner
2021-11-15x86: Add high bitdepth mc bilin/8-tap AVX-512 (Ice Lake) asmHenrik Gramner
2021-11-13x86/itx: Add 8x8 12bpc AVX2 transformsMatthias Dressel
2021-11-13x86/itx: Add 8x4 12bpc AVX2 transformsMatthias Dressel
2021-11-13x86/itx: Add 4x8 12bpc AVX2 transformsMatthias Dressel
2021-11-10x86: Fix invalid memory access in cdef_filter_8x8_8bpc_avx512iclHenrik Gramner
2021-11-02x86/itx: Add clipping to iadst 4x16Matthias Dressel
2021-10-29Remove lpf_stride parameter from LR filtersVictorien Le Couviour--Tuffet
2021-10-29Allow CDEF and LR to run sbrows in parallelVictorien Le Couviour--Tuffet
2021-10-18x86/itx: Add 12-bit 4x4 transforms in AVX2Matthias Dressel
2021-10-18x86/itx: Rename rax to r6Matthias Dressel
2021-10-18x86/itx: Name constants more explicitMatthias Dressel
2021-10-18x86: Add splat_mv AVX-512 (Ice Lake) asmHenrik Gramner
2021-10-18x86: Add deblock loop filters AVX-512 (Ice Lake) asmVictorien Le Couviour--Tuffet
2021-10-18x86: Add sgr AVX-512 (Ice Lake) asmHenrik Gramner
2021-10-18x86: Add wiener_filter AVX-512 (Ice Lake) asmHenrik Gramner
2021-10-18x86: Add ipred_filter AVX-512 (Ice Lake) asmHenrik Gramner
2021-10-18x86: Add ipred dc/h/v/paeth/smooth/pal_pred AVX-512 (Ice Lake) asmHenrik Gramner
2021-10-18x86: Add inverse transforms AVX-512 (Ice Lake) asmHenrik Gramner
2021-10-18x86: Add blend AVX-512 (Ice Lake) asmHenrik Gramner
2021-10-18x86: Add warp_affine_8x8 AVX-512 (Ice Lake) asmHenrik Gramner
2021-10-18x86: Add mc 8-tap AVX-512 (Ice Lake) asmHenrik Gramner
2021-10-18x86: Add mc put_bilin AVX-512 (Ice Lake) asmHenrik Gramner
2021-10-18x86: Remove the option to disable AVX-512Henrik Gramner
2021-09-20x86: Add high bitdepth mc(t)_scaled AVX2 asmVictorien Le Couviour--Tuffet
2021-09-08Simplify sgr_x_by_x calculationsHenrik Gramner
2021-09-05x86: Optimize shifts in 8-bit wiener_filter asmHenrik Gramner
2021-09-03x86: Simplify loopfilter initMatthias Dressel
2021-09-02x86: Add high bitdepth cfl_ac_444 AVX2 asmHenrik Gramner
2021-09-02x86: Improve high bitdepth cfl_ac AVX2 asmHenrik Gramner
2021-08-30x86: Add 8-bit w_mask_422 and w_mask_444 SSSE3 asmHenrik Gramner
2021-08-23x86: Improve high bitdepth cdef_filter AVX2 asmHenrik Gramner
2021-08-23x86: Prefer tzcnt over bsr in cdef sec_shift calculationsHenrik Gramner
2021-08-20x86: Add splat_mv AVX2 asmHenrik Gramner
2021-08-20x86: Add splat_mv SSE2 asmChristophe Gisquet
2021-08-17x86/itx: 64x64 inverse dct transforms hbd/sse4Ronald S. Bultje
2021-08-17x86/itx: 64x32 inverse dct transforms hbd/sse4Ronald S. Bultje
2021-08-17x86/itx: 64x16 inverse dct transforms hbd/sse4Ronald S. Bultje
2021-08-17x86/itx: 32x64 inverse dct transforms hbd/sse4Ronald S. Bultje
2021-08-17x86/itx: 16x64 inverse dct transforms hbd/sse4Ronald S. Bultje
2021-08-16x86: Add high bitdepth cdef_filter SSSE3 asmHenrik Gramner
2021-08-16cdef: Remove redundant clippingHenrik Gramner
2021-08-12itx/x86: rewrite .transpose4x8packed so it uses only m0-3,4&6Ronald S. Bultje
2021-08-12itx/x86: replace idct8x8.transpose with idct8x4.transpose4x8packedRonald S. Bultje
2021-08-12x86/itx: add 1/sqrt(2) (rect2) multiply macroRonald S. Bultje
2021-08-12x86/itx: share pass2 loop between {16,32}x32 dct^2 functionsRonald S. Bultje
2021-08-12x86/itx: combine .write_8x8 and .round{1,2,3,4} into a single functionRonald S. Bultje
2021-08-12x86/itx: combine .write_8x4 and .round{1,2} into a single functionRonald S. Bultje